Playwright and Director (WIT #310)

Playwright and DirectorPlaywright, Director and Choreographer

Director Bob Balaban (Y2K), playwrights Richard Greenberg (Take Me Out) and Suheir Hammad (Russell Simmons Def Poetry Jam), choreographer Luis Perez (Man of La Mancha) and director David Petrarca (A Year With Frog and Toad) discuss the condition of American theatre both in New York and around the country, and some of the shifts that are occurring both in audience expectations and the direction of new works.

Original airdate - April 1, 2003.
Running time - 90 minutes.
